India in Transition: A Study in Political Evolution is a book written by Aga Khan in 1918. The book provides an in-depth analysis of India's political evolution and the challenges faced by the country during the early 20th century. The author, who was an influential leader of the Indian Muslim community, discusses the impact of British colonialism on India's political, social, and economic conditions. The book covers a wide range of topics, including India's struggle for independence, the role of different political parties and leaders, the impact of Western education and modernization on Indian society, and the challenges faced by India's diverse religious and ethnic communities. The author also provides insights into the political and social conditions of India's neighboring countries, including Afghanistan, Persia, and Turkey. Overall, India in Transition is a comprehensive study of India's political evolution during a crucial period in its history. It offers valuable insights into the challenges faced by India and its people, and the efforts made by various leaders and communities to overcome them.
